Beyonce, Drake team up

Two of music's top-selling stars have come together briefly, as rapper Drake put out a new song featuring pop superstar Beyonce. He brought her in on Can I?, which runs for only around two minutes and where she recites one line, "Can I, baby?", repeatedly over one of his trademark slow beats.

It started airing officially over the weekend on Beats 1, Apple's online radio station where Drake is a major player. $1.8m for Tintin work


A rare drawing of comic book hero Tintin fetched

HK$9.6 million (S$1.77 million) at auction in Hong Kong on Monday.

The artwork is an illustration from Belgian cartoonist Herge's 1936 book, The Blue Lotus, which sees Tintin and Snowy the dog on an adventure in Shanghai. French auction house Artcurial said the buyer was an Asian collector.

Drawn in monochrome, the artwork shows Tintin being pulled along a street in a rickshaw with a policeman looking on. It is the only original from the book to remain in private hands, Artcurial said.


Artist Ai Weiwei bugged?

Chinese dissident artist Ai Weiwei on Sunday posted photos on his Instagram account that suggest listening devices were planted in his Beijing studio. The pictures were of wires pulled out from a wall socket and another device with about a dozen wires protruding from it.

"Ai Weiwei returned to Beijing and unexpectedly discovered a four-year-old secret when decorating his studio," lawyer Liu Xiaoyuan wrote on Twitter, apparently referring to the artist's detention in 2011 for 81 days.
